Description:
Inside upper cover: paper pastedown on pigskin with a University of Leeds Brotherton Collection bookplate and a book label for William Merton. Bound by Katherine Adams for £6. 3s.

Provenance:
Late 15th-century (?) ownership inscription on fol. 90r: 'Henry Chicetor (?) ous thes boke'.
Provenance:
Merton, Wilfred (a modern typed note states that on 17 May 1913 the manuscripts was purchased by Wilfred Merton from Bertram Dobell, of Tunbridge Wells, for 16s).
Provenance:
Late 15th-century (?) inscription amongst scribbles on fol. 33v reads: 'Explicit liber quod Iohn Slareffe' (?).
Provenance:
Purchased for the Brotherton Collection from M. Breslauer, 4 June 1958.
